How families and households are made up across the area.
Larger households are common in postcode 3954, where over half of all families are couples with children. This area sees far fewer single-parent families than the national average, making it a place where multi-person homes are the norm.

Average household size.
Most homes here hold two people (40.3%), though the overall household size is higher than in most areas. Only 24.3% of residents live alone, which is a little below the figures for Victoria and Australia.

Family types and one-parent families.
Families with couples and children make up 55.3% of the area. This helps explain why one-parent families are well below the national figure, accounting for only 8.6% of the total.
